Output 879896c1d13fd39d0cc7a1fb34bfa65d899c403ce0a05ae6911bece4b2578c28:1

value
4125980900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 858f2a9487fb41adcfcf46f4f18f947571cd9bd1 OP_EQUALVERIFY OP_CHECKSIG
address
1DBCNtJ1gFMLrJRVaTrqpQRRz6P9v3a2sw
transaction
879896c1d13fd39d0cc7a1fb34bfa65d899c403ce0a05ae6911bece4b2578c28
spent
true